Fathom Nickel

Gochager Lake can Fathom mineralisation extension

Fathom Nickel (CSE:FNI) has mapped the Gochager Lake deposit to extend for a minimum length of 3.5km following a rock geochemistry program at the project in Saskatchewan, Canada.

The company says the campaign revealed consistently occurring surface outcrops with disseminated sulphide mineralisation, trending northeast from the Gochager Lake deposit towards and under Scurry Lake.

This program marks the second prospecting campaign, running from September to October after wildfires in July revealed new outcrop exposure, using portable x-ray fluorescence (pXRF).

CEO Ian Fraser says the company utilised historical drilling results to guide the exploration activities. 

“We are currently interpreting and compiling the summer soil geochemistry program results with the new geology map and will release those results when complete,” Fraser says.  

Fathom collected 684 outcrop chip samples, using pXRF to update the geology map.

“The expanded container rock defined to date now is developing into a very linear feature that is consistent with the geological settings of many of the world’s premier magmatic nickel districts,” the CEO says. 

“The 3.5km of Gochager container rock gives us an expanded playing field for additional discoveries of significant bodies of semi-massive to massive nickel-copper-cobalt sulphide mineralisation.”

Located 75km north-northeast of La Ronge and 22km west-northwest of Missinipe, Gochager spans 33,629 hectares and is prospective for nickel-copper-cobalt mineralisation. 

Fathom Nickel is a mineral explorer focused on developing magmatic nickel sulphide deposits in North America.
